Annotation: The Definition, Use Case, and Relevance for Enterprises

CATEGORY:  
AI Data Handling and Management
Dashboard mockup

What is it?

The main value covered in the term “annotation” is the act of adding notes, comments, or additional information to a document, image, or piece of data. Annotations provide context and clarity to the original content, making it easier to understand and interpret. This can be done through various methods such as highlighting, underlining, or adding written notes. In the context of artificial intelligence, annotation is particularly important for training machine learning models, as it helps to label and categorize data for future analysis and prediction.

Annotation is crucial for business people because it allows for better organization and interpretation of data. By adding annotations to important documents or data sets, business professionals can highlight key information and provide additional context for future reference. This can be especially useful in decision-making processes, as annotated data provides a deeper understanding of the factors influencing a particular outcome. In the realm of artificial intelligence, annotation is vital for training and improving machine learning models, which can have significant implications for businesses seeking to automate processes and gain insights from large volumes of data. In summary, annotation adds value by enhancing the understanding and interpretation of data, ultimately leading to more informed business decisions and improved AI technologies.

How does it work?

"Annotation in AI refers to the process of labeling or adding additional information to data for better organization and understanding. Think of it like adding sticky notes to a book to highlight important sections or add explanations. By annotating data, AI systems can learn to recognize patterns and make better predictions.

In the world of AI, annotation involves categorizing or tagging data to help algorithms make sense of it. This can involve labeling images with objects or faces, adding keywords to text, or marking sentiments in reviews. By providing this annotated data, AI models can then be trained to recognize these patterns and make accurate predictions or classifications. Overall, annotation is a crucial step in the AI learning process to ensure models can understand and interpret data effectively."

Pros

  1. Artificial intelligence has the potential to greatly improve efficiency and productivity in various industries, as it can automate repetitive tasks and analyze vast amounts of data at a much faster rate than humans.
  2. AI technology can help in making better and more informed decisions, as it has the ability to process and analyze large amounts of complex information in a short amount of time.
  3. AI can provide personalized experiences for users, such as personalized recommendations and tailored content, leading to improved customer satisfaction and loyalty.

Cons

  1. There are concerns about the potential loss of jobs as AI continues to automate tasks that were previously performed by humans.
  2. The use of AI raises ethical concerns, particularly in terms of privacy and security, as it requires access to vast amounts of personal data in order to function effectively.
  3. There is a risk of bias in AI systems, as they are trained on historical data which may reflect existing biases and inequalities in society. This could result in unfair or discriminatory outcomes.

Applications and Examples

In the context of artificial intelligence, annotation refers to the process of labeling or tagging data to make it understandable by machines. For example, in the field of natural language processing, annotating text data involves identifying and marking up different components of the text, such as named entities, parts of speech, or sentiment.

This annotated data can then be used to train machine learning models to understand and process human language more accurately. In the field of computer vision, annotating images involves marking objects, shapes, and patterns within the image, which can then be used to train machine learning algorithms to identify and classify objects in new images.

Interplay - Low-code AI and GenAI drag and drop development

History and Evolution

The term "annotation" has its roots in the Latin word "annotare," meaning to note or remark. It was first used in the 14th century to refer to the act of adding explanatory notes or comments to a text. In the context of artificial intelligence, annotation is crucial for training machine learning algorithms and improving the accuracy of data labeling, which is essential for developing AI systems.

Today, annotation plays a vital role in helping AI understand and interpret the vast amount of data it processes, ultimately leading to more effective and efficient AI applications.

FAQs

What is AI annotation?

AI annotation is the process of labeling data for training AI models, where humans identify and classify objects in images, videos, or text to provide the machine with labeled examples to learn from.

Why is AI annotation important?

AI annotation is crucial for building accurate and effective AI models, as it provides the labeled data necessary for training the machine to recognize patterns and make informed decisions.

What are the different types of AI annotation?

Common types of AI annotation include image annotation (bounding boxes, polygons, keypoints), video annotation (object tracking, activity recognition), and text annotation (named entity recognition, sentiment analysis).

How is AI annotation different from data labeling?

AI annotation is a specific type of data labeling that is focused on creating labeled datasets for training AI models, while data labeling may encompass a broader range of activities, such as data categorization and organization.

What tools are used for AI annotation?

Tools for AI annotation include labeling software like Labelbox, Amazon SageMaker Ground Truth, and open-source options like LabelImg and VGG Image Annotator, which provide interfaces for humans to annotate data with labels and annotations.

Takeaways

The term ""annotation"" refers to the act of adding notes, comments, or explanations to a text or document. Annotations can provide additional context, insights, or clarifications to the original content, making it easier for readers to understand and engage with the material. They can also be used to highlight key points, make connections to other sources, or provide critical analysis.

In the business context, annotations can be a valuable tool for team collaboration, project management, and knowledge sharing. They can help employees to better understand complex documents, track changes and updates, and provide feedback and suggestions for improvement. Understanding how to effectively use annotations can improve communication and decision-making within a business, leading to more efficient workflows and better outcomes for the organization.

It is important for business people to understand the concept of annotations because it can enhance their ability to communicate effectively and work collaboratively with others. By mastering the art of annotation, individuals can improve their reading comprehension, critical thinking, and analytical skills, which are essential for success in the business world. Additionally, knowing how to use annotations can streamline processes, facilitate information sharing, and ultimately contribute to the overall productivity and success of a business.